Guidance on Selecting Woodworking Education in Glasgow

The following guidance is designed to assist individuals seeking woodworking instruction in Glasgow. Careful consideration of these points can facilitate a more rewarding and effective learning experience.

Tip 1: Define Learning Objectives: Prior to enrollment, determine specific woodworking skills to acquire. For instance, prospective students should clarify whether the goal is to learn furniture restoration, cabinet making, or basic carpentry techniques. Clearly defined objectives streamline the selection process.

Tip 2: Assess Skill Level: Accurately evaluate existing woodworking proficiency. Beginners benefit from introductory courses covering fundamental skills and safety procedures. Experienced woodworkers should seek advanced workshops focusing on specialized techniques.

Tip 3: Evaluate Course Content: Carefully examine the curriculum of each offering. Ensure the content aligns with the defined learning objectives and skill level. A detailed syllabus should be readily available.

Tip 4: Consider Instructor Experience: Research the instructor’s background and qualifications. A seasoned woodworking professional with demonstrated teaching experience is preferable. Reviewing instructor portfolios and testimonials can provide valuable insight.

Tip 5: Review Workshop Facilities: Inspect the workshop environment prior to enrollment. Adequate space, appropriate tools, and a safe working environment are essential for effective learning. Ensure the facility complies with relevant safety regulations.

Tip 6: Investigate Class Size: Optimal learning occurs in small class settings. Smaller classes allow for more individualized attention from the instructor. Consider the student-to-instructor ratio before committing to a particular class.

Tip 7: Compare Pricing and Schedules: Evaluate course fees, material costs, and scheduling options. Ensure the selected course fits within budgetary constraints and personal availability. Consider courses offered at various times and locations.

Selecting appropriate instruction is paramount for successful woodworking skill acquisition. By carefully considering these points, individuals can maximize their learning potential and minimize potential frustrations.

2. Course Content

2. Course Content, Class

The composition of course curricula is fundamentally important when evaluating woodworking educational opportunities within Glasgow. The subject matter, scope, and depth of a course significantly influence the skills acquired and the overall learning experience. A thorough review of content is critical to ensure alignment with individual learning goals.

  • Joinery Techniques

    This facet encompasses the fundamental methods of joining wood pieces together. Instruction covers techniques such as mortise and tenon, dovetail, and rabbet joints. Practical application involves constructing small projects that reinforce these methods. The successful completion of this content equips students with the foundational skills necessary for furniture making and other complex woodworking endeavors. The absence of adequate joinery instruction limits the ability to create structurally sound and aesthetically pleasing wooden objects.

  • Wood Selection and Properties

    A comprehensive understanding of wood types, their characteristics, and appropriate applications is essential. This includes identifying different species, understanding grain patterns, and assessing wood density and strength. Instruction also addresses the impact of moisture content on wood stability. Practical exercises involve selecting appropriate wood for specific projects based on these properties. Neglecting this aspect can lead to project failure due to wood warping, cracking, or structural weakness.

  • Tool Usage and Maintenance

    Proper usage and maintenance of both hand tools and power tools are crucial for safety and precision. Instruction covers the correct operation of saws, planes, chisels, routers, and other essential woodworking implements. Emphasis is placed on safety procedures, blade sharpening, and routine maintenance. Practical exercises involve using each tool under supervision. Inadequate tool training increases the risk of injury and diminishes the quality of finished projects.

  • Finishing Techniques

    The final stage of woodworking involves applying finishes to protect and enhance the wood’s appearance. Instruction covers various finishing methods, including sanding, staining, varnishing, and oiling. Students learn about different types of finishes, their properties, and appropriate application techniques. Practical exercises involve applying finishes to sample pieces. Neglecting finishing techniques results in projects that are vulnerable to damage and lack aesthetic appeal.

4. Workshop Safety

4. Workshop Safety, Class

Within the framework of woodworking classes in Glasgow, adherence to rigorous safety protocols is paramount. The inherent risks associated with woodworking machinery and hand tools necessitate a comprehensive and consistently enforced safety regime to mitigate potential hazards and ensure the well-being of all participants. The following points outline essential facets of workshop safety in this context.

  • Personal Protective Equipment (PPE)

    The consistent use of appropriate PPE is fundamental to preventing injuries. This includes, but is not limited to, safety glasses or goggles to protect against flying debris, hearing protection to mitigate noise exposure from power tools, and dust masks or respirators to prevent inhalation of sawdust and other airborne particles. An example is the mandatory wearing of safety glasses when operating a lathe, preventing eye injuries from wood chips. Failure to utilize PPE significantly elevates the risk of lacerations, eye damage, and respiratory illnesses within the workshop environment. Woodworking classes in Glasgow must mandate and enforce the use of such equipment.

  • Machine Guarding and Operational Procedures

    Ensuring that all woodworking machinery is equipped with functioning guards and that operators adhere to safe operational procedures is critical. Guards prevent accidental contact with moving blades, belts, and other hazardous components. Standard operating procedures include proper tool setup, material feeding techniques, and emergency shutdown protocols. For instance, a table saw must have a blade guard and anti-kickback pawls in place, and operators must use push sticks to keep their hands away from the blade. Circumventing machine guards or deviating from established procedures increases the likelihood of severe injuries, including amputations and deep cuts. Woodworking classes in Glasgow must provide thorough training on safe machine operation and enforce adherence to these procedures.

  • Dust Collection and Ventilation

    Effective dust collection and ventilation systems are essential for maintaining a safe and healthy workshop environment. Woodworking generates significant amounts of dust, which can pose respiratory hazards and increase the risk of fire. Dust collection systems capture dust at the source, preventing it from becoming airborne. Ventilation systems remove contaminated air from the workshop and replace it with fresh air. An example is the use of a dust collector connected to a sander, capturing fine dust particles before they can be inhaled. Inadequate dust control can lead to chronic respiratory problems and an increased risk of fire or explosion. Woodworking classes in Glasgow must prioritize dust collection and ventilation to protect the health and safety of participants.

  • Emergency Procedures and First Aid

    Having well-defined emergency procedures and readily available first aid supplies is crucial for responding to accidents and injuries. Emergency procedures should include evacuation plans, contact information for emergency services, and protocols for handling specific types of injuries. First aid supplies should be readily accessible and appropriately stocked. An example is the presence of a clearly marked first aid kit containing bandages, antiseptic wipes, and a burn treatment cream, coupled with trained personnel who can administer first aid. The absence of adequate emergency procedures and first aid provisions can delay treatment and worsen the outcome of injuries. Woodworking classes in Glasgow must establish and communicate emergency procedures, maintain readily accessible first aid supplies, and ensure that personnel are trained in basic first aid.

6. Material Costs

6. Material Costs, Class

The expenses associated with materials represent a significant consideration for individuals contemplating enrollment in woodworking classes within Glasgow. These costs, which can vary substantially depending on the nature of the course and the specific projects undertaken, directly impact the overall affordability and accessibility of such educational opportunities. Understanding the components of material costs and their implications is crucial for informed decision-making.

  • Wood Type and Quantity

    The primary driver of material costs is the selection of wood species and the quantity required for project completion. Exotic hardwoods, such as walnut or cherry, command significantly higher prices compared to softwoods like pine or fir. The dimensions of the project, whether a small box or a large piece of furniture, dictate the volume of wood needed. For example, a basic introductory course may utilize inexpensive pine for initial projects, while an advanced class focused on furniture making may require students to purchase more costly hardwoods. This cost is the responsibility of the student. As for the classes, there are ways to get woodworking supplies in glasgow if in need.

  • Consumables (Adhesives, Fasteners, Finishes)

    In addition to lumber, various consumable materials contribute to the overall cost. Adhesives, such as wood glue, are essential for bonding joints. Fasteners, including screws, nails, and dowels, provide additional structural support. Finishes, such as stains, varnishes, and oils, protect and enhance the appearance of the finished product. The type and quantity of these consumables depend on the specific project. For instance, a project requiring intricate joinery may necessitate specialized adhesives, while a project involving staining and varnishing will require appropriate finishing products. There are stores that sell consumables throughout the city.

  • Tooling and Abrasives

    While woodworking classes typically provide access to essential tools, students may be required to purchase certain personal tools or accessories. These may include measuring tools, marking gauges, hand planes, chisels, or specialized cutting tools. Additionally, abrasive materials, such as sandpaper, are consumed during the sanding and finishing process. The cost of these items varies depending on the quality and type of tool. For example, a student may choose to invest in high-quality hand planes for greater precision and control, while others may opt for more affordable alternatives. Abrasives are consumable and must be provided by the student.

  • Project Complexity and Scale

    The complexity and scale of the projects undertaken in a woodworking class directly correlate with material costs. More intricate projects involving complex joinery, detailed carving, or the use of specialized hardware require a greater investment in materials. Larger-scale projects, such as constructing a cabinet or a table, necessitate a greater volume of wood and other supplies. Therefore, prospective students should carefully consider the projects included in a course’s curriculum and their associated material costs when making enrollment decisions.

Frequently Asked Questions

The subsequent section addresses common inquiries regarding woodworking educational opportunities within Glasgow. These responses are intended to provide clarity and facilitate informed decision-making for prospective students.

Question 1: Are prior woodworking skills necessary to enroll in introductory level classes?

No prior experience is typically required for introductory woodworking classes. These courses are designed to provide beginners with foundational knowledge and skills. Instruction typically commences with basic safety procedures, tool identification, and fundamental joinery techniques.

Question 2: What tools and materials are provided by the class versus what must be purchased separately?

The provision of tools and materials varies between courses. Most classes supply access to essential power tools and specialized equipment. However, students may be responsible for purchasing personal safety gear, hand tools, and project-specific materials. Detailed information regarding material requirements is typically provided in the course description or syllabus.

Question 3: What is the typical class size and student-to-instructor ratio?

Class sizes range depending on the type of course and facilities. Smaller class sizes generally allow for individualized attention. The student-to-instructor ratio should be a key consideration when choosing woodworking instruction.

Question 4: What safety precautions are implemented and expected of participants?

Strict adherence to safety protocols is paramount. Participants are expected to wear appropriate personal protective equipment, including safety glasses, hearing protection, and dust masks. Safe tool operation and adherence to established procedures are mandatory. Detailed safety guidelines are typically provided at the beginning of each course.

Question 5: What are the career prospects after completing woodworking classes?

Completion of woodworking courses can open diverse avenues. Participants may find opportunities in furniture making, carpentry, joinery, or related fields. Some may pursue woodworking as a hobby or for personal projects. Additionally, skills acquired can be valuable for home improvement and DIY endeavors.
